Massimo d'Azeglio was an influential Italian painter, writer, and politician who played a crucial role in the Risorgimento, the movement for Italian unification. Born in Turin, he initially pursued a career in the arts, where his talents in painting and literature flourished. D'Azeglio's literary works, particularly his novel 'Ettore Fieramosca', showcased his deep nationalistic sentiments and provided a narrative on the struggles against foreign domination in Italy.
